Syrian Air Force Bombs ISIL’s Positions, Movements in Homs Province

 

The Syrian Army aircraft pounded ISIL’s positions and movements in Eastern and Southwestern Homs, inflicting major losses on the terrorists on Tuesday.

The fighter jets carried out several bombardments on ISIL strongholds in al-Mo’ayzileh region and al-Mo’ayzileh dam in Eastern Badiyeh (desert) and East of al-Heil oilfield near the town of Palmyra (Tadmur).

The warplanes further struck ISIL’s movements near al-Mohasa Mountain South of the town of al-Quaryatayn in Southwestern Homs.

ISIL suffered a number of casualties and its vehicles and equipment were destroyed in the air raids.

The Syrian Army troops repelled terrorist groups’ heavy offensive in Northern Homs on Wednesday, inflicting heavy casualties on the militants and destroying their equipment.

The army men, backed up by the artillery and missile units, fended off terrorists’ heavy attack in the villages of Jowalik and Sanisal in Northern Homs.

The artillery and missile units pounded the movements and positions of the terrorists in a region between the villages of Kisin and al-Qajar and another region between the villages of Zomaymir and Qanateh, killing a number of terrorists and destroying their military vehicles.
